Web8 Feb 2024 · On American keyboards, the £ is normally replaced with a hash (#), as you can see on this Vissles keyboard pictured below: That doesn’t mean you can’t type a £ sign by pressing Shift + 3, though. As long as your operating system is set to UK English, the £ should still appear when you type Shift + 3. How to change keyboard language Web26 Sep 2016 · Go to System Preferences - Keyboard - Input Sources. There you can use + sign to enable British keyboard which has £ sign on shift+3. You can also checkbox "Show Input menu in menu bar" so you can easily switch between different keyboards.

On an Apple Keyboard, whilst using a third-party OS such as Windows, you type the # symbol by pressing the 2nd Alt key + 3. The first (left hand side) Alt key doesn't have a shortcut function.
